Time the record covers

At least 15 million years on record.

The record covers at least 15.98 Mya to 774 ka. No occurrence read is dated outside 23.04 Mya to 129 ka.

32 occurrences of Coanicardita californica on record, most of them in the Pleistocene. Bar height is expected occurrences, not a count: each fossil is spread across the span it is dated to, so a tall narrow bar means tight dating and a low wide one means loose.

These are dates about fossils, not the animal: the record can only begin after it arose and end before it died out, so either end may reach further. Shares are expected occurrences: a fossil dated to a span is counted partly in each period it straddles. More on what this infers.
